Output baa87315999a96e40b5d4a83d5f1228cd14cc0cf095e031450077096037fc1e3:1

value
993834
script pubkey
OP_0 OP_PUSHBYTES_20 56934200737ab91dfaad5b479aa2a47c28b14261
address
bc1q26f5yqrn02u3m74dtdre4g4y0s5tzsnpch6tph
transaction
baa87315999a96e40b5d4a83d5f1228cd14cc0cf095e031450077096037fc1e3
confirmations
139137
spent
true